What does a Luxury Accessories and Lighting Designer do? In the Luxury Accessories and Lighting Designer role at Villa & House, you will be at the forefront of designing exquisite home accessories, lighting, mirrors, and other small goods that embody our luxury brand. Your responsibilities will involve researching and developing innovative concepts that capture the essence of sophistication, while ensuring alignment with production requirements through the use of CAD software. You'll bring your creative visions to life by sketching designs and crafting prototypes, collaborating with manufacturers to implement cost-effective strategies for the final product. This role encourages ample global research for design inspiration, allowing your work to resonate with our brand voice and customer-centric approach. As you navigate the intricate world of Accessory Design, Lamp Design, and Mirror Design, your contributions will play a pivotal role in enhancing our reputation for excellence in the luxury furniture industry.
